Functionalization of N-arylglycine esters: Electrocatalytic access to C-C bonds mediated by n-Bu4NI
Luo, Mi-Hai,Jiang, Yang-Ye,Xu, Kun,Liu, Yong-Guo,Sun, Bao-Guo,Zeng, Cheng-Chu
, p. 499 - 505 (2018)
An efficient electrocatalytic functionalization of N-arylglycine esters is reported. The protocol proceeds in an undivided cell under constant current conditions employing the simple, cheap and readily available n-Bu4NI as the mediator. In addition, it is demonstrated that the mediated process is superior to the direct electrochemical functionalization.
Cross-dehydrogenative coupling reactions by transition-metal and aminocatalysis for the synthesis of amino acid derivatives
Xie, Jin,Huang, Zhi-Zhen
supporting information; experimental part, p. 10181 - 10185 (2011/02/27)
The direct approach: The title coupling reactions of N-aryl glycine esters with unmodified ketones occurred smoothly in the presence of tert-butyl hydroperoxide (TBHP) or 2,3-dichloro-5,6-dicyano-1,4-benzoquinone (DDQ) under mild conditions (see scheme). The oxidant used for C-H activation determined the selectivity of the reactions for a particular type of ketone substrate. Copyright
